Product Description:

The MAC041A-0-FS-4-E/050-B-0/WI651LV servomotor from Bosch Rexroth Indramat are made to meet the tough needs of industrial automation. This motor comes in size 41, works precisely and lasts a long time. The product is designed to be reliable and flexible, and it has advanced features that make it work smoothly in a many industrial applications.

The MAC041A-0-FS-4-E/050-B-0/WI651LV servomotor has a maximum torque of 0.59 Nm and can run at 4270/min when it has 90% of its maximum torque. It is made with a torque constant of 0.330 Nm/A, which makes sure that the torque control is accurate and stable. With a duty cycle (ED) of 25%, this motor is best for sporadic use. It also has a holding brake torque of 1.3 Nm that makes it safer to use. It meets IP54 to IP67 standards, which means it is well protected against dust and water. While the motor performs well in temperatures ranging from -20°C to 50°C, it can also operate dependably in colder or warmer conditions. Because of these features, the motor is a good choice for complex tasks.

For easy integration into current industrial systems, the MAC041A-0-FS-4-E/050-B-0/WI651LV servomotor is built with advanced communication features. It supports Ethernet-based protocols like EtherCAT, Ethernet/IP, PROFINET, Powerlink, and Modbus TCP. It also comes with fieldbus choices like CANopen and Profibus, which make it more useful in a wide range of industrial settings. The motor works quickly and reliably for important industrial automation jobs because it has high performance, advanced connectivity, and a strong build. Frequently Asked Questions about MAC041A-0-FS-4-E/050-B-0/WI651LV:

Q: Why does MAC041A-0-FS-4-E/050-B-0/WI651LV have a 25% duty cycle?

A: The 25% duty cycle allows the motor to operate effectively in intermittent applications. It prevents overheating during short, demanding tasks.

Q: How does MAC041A-0-FS-4-E/050-B-0/WI651LV handle torque precision?

A: It features a torque constant of 0.330 Nm/A. This ensures consistent and precise torque delivery during operation for optimal performance.

Q: Why does MAC041A-0-FS-4-E/050-B-0/WI651LV support Ethernet-based protocols?

A: Ethernet-based protocols enable seamless integration into industrial networks. They enhance communication efficiency and compatibility with advanced automation systems.

Q: Does MAC041A-0-FS-4-E/050-B-0/WI651LV meet IP67 protection standards?

A: Yes, it complies with IP54 to IP67 ratings. This ensures the motor is protected from dust and water ingress in demanding environments.

Q: How does MAC041A-0-FS-4-E/050-B-0/WI651LV ensure operational safety?

A: It includes a holding brake torque of 1.3 Nm. This feature enhances safety by securely holding the load when needed.
